What is a Mobility Scooter?
A mobility scooter is an electric-powered car designed to help individuals with walking problems. They are generally 3 or four-wheels and are managed utilizing handlebars or a tiller. Mobility scooters are ideal for those who need a more steady and comfortable alternative to walking, particularly over longer ranges.

Actions to Select the Right Mobility Scooter
Examine Your Needs
- Determine the main purpose of the scooter (e.g., indoor usage, outside use, fars away, shopping trips).
- Consider your physical condition and any particular features you require, such as adjustable seating or folding abilities.
Research Models
- Compare different models based upon elements like speed, variety, weight capability, and battery life.
- Try to find features that improve safety and comfort, such as anti-tip wheels and ergonomic controls.
Test Drive
- Schedule a test drive with the dealership to experience the scooter firsthand.
- Focus on how it feels to operate the scooter, especially if you have any mobility or balance problems.
Ask Questions
- Ask about the scooter's performance, upkeep requirements, and any additional devices or adjustments that can be made.
- Inquire about the dealer's policies concerning returns, exchanges, and repairs.
Compare Prices
- Get quotes from several dealers to guarantee you are getting the very best deal.
- Consider the total expense of ownership, consisting of maintenance, batteries, and any additional costs.

Q: What is the average cost of a mobility scooter?A: The expense of a mobility scooter can differ commonly depending on the design, functions, and brand. Standard models can start around ₤ 500, while advanced and durable scooters can cost ₤ 2,000 to ₤ 5,000 or more. Some dealers may offer financing choices or discount rates for elders and veterans.

Q: How frequently do I need to maintain my mobility scooter?A: Regular upkeep is vital to keep your mobility scooter running efficiently and safely. The majority of dealers recommend buying a mobility scooter service check every six months, but this can vary depending on usage. Standard maintenance consists of checking tire pressure, battery levels, and guaranteeing all parts are operating properly.
Q: Can I utilize a mobility scooter inside your home and outdoors?A: Many mobility scooters near me scooters are created for both indoor and outside use. However, some models are better suited for particular environments. For instance, indoor scooters are usually smaller sized and more maneuverable, while outdoor scooters are built to handle rougher surface and longer distances. Guarantee the design you choose fulfills your primary use needs.
